Seminarziel

PeopleTools II expands on the skills acquired in PeopleTools I. In this five-day course, students gain advanced development and troubleshooting experience as they create applications that incorporate complex features such as views, multiple occurs levels, tableset sharing, subrecords, subpages, links, and PeopleCode.
Learn To: o Troubleshoot applications o Create records and pages that maintain parent child relationships o Enhance application and page functionality o Create and use sub records and sub pages o Write basic PeopleCode programs o Create and use views

Zielgruppe

Entwickler, Systemanalytiker, Technischer Berater, Formsentwickler

Seminarinhalte

o Apply PeopleSoft Design Methodology in developing applications o Create and use views as the basis for summary pages, search records, and prompt tables o Explain and implement table set sharing o Create records and pages that maintain parent child relationships o Explain the buffer allocation process and its impact on application performance o Create and use sub records and sub pages in an application o Write PeopleCode programs to satisfy business requirements and enhance applications o Enhance application and page functionality using advanced PeopleTools features, such as images, links, and deferred processing o Troubleshoot common problems in PeopleSoft applications
